awesome-repositories.com
© 2026 Bringes Technology SRL·VAT RO45896025·hello@bringes.io
MCPSitemapPrivacyTerms
EasySpider | Awesome Repository
← All repositories

NaiboWang/EasySpider

0
View on GitHub↗
44,100 stars·5,397 forks·JavaScript·agpl-3.0·1 viewwww.easyspider.net↗

EasySpider

Features

  • No-Code Automation Platforms - Provides a visual environment for building and executing complex browser-based workflows.
  • Visual Web Scraping Tools - Provides a graphical interface for designing data extraction tasks by interacting directly with web elements.
  • No-Code Automation - Builds and executes repetitive web-based workflows without needing programming knowledge.
  • Browser Task Orchestrators - Automates repetitive web interactions and data collection processes by simulating human navigation.
  • No-Code Platforms - Executes complex tasks through a no-code interface.
  • Web Scraping Tools - Gathers structured information from websites and saves it into organized formats.
  • Browser Automation Engines - Provides a headless browser engine to simulate user interactions and extract data from web pages.
  • Visual Design Tools - Creates automated data collection tasks by interacting with a browser interface.
  • Browser Automation Testing - Simulates user interactions within a web browser to verify site features and data flows.
  • Workflow Orchestrators - Maps user-defined scraping tasks into a structured execution graph that drives browser actions.
  • EasySpider is a no-code automation platform designed to orchestrate repetitive web interactions and data collection processes. It functions as a browser task orchestrator, providing a visual environment where users can build and execute complex workflows through point-and-click configuration rather than manual programming.

    The platform distinguishes itself by enabling visual web scraping design, allowing users to create data extraction tasks by interacting directly with web elements. It utilizes a headless browser engine to simulate human navigation and event-driven interactions, mapping these actions into a structured execution graph. This approach allows for the creation of portable scraping logic, which is serialized into data files for consistent execution across different environments.

    Beyond data gathering, the software supports browser automation testing to verify site features and data flows. It maintains compatibility across various operating systems through integration with standard web automation drivers, ensuring that complex workflows can be managed without requiring programming knowledge.